    I bought this Civil War token from a local coin dealer today. It's designated Fuld 46/339a and is a common R-1 variety. One outstanding feature of this token though is the huge
    die crack on the reverse. This has got to be one of the last pieces struck with the die before it shattered all together. The other feature worth noting is the ugliness of the portrait of Liberty...Yikes! The diesinker must have done this rendition shortly after waking up from a nightmare.
